Distance From Aviosuperficie del Parteolla to Nnamdi Azikiwe International Airport

The distance from Aviosuperficie del Parteolla () to Nnamdi Azikiwe International Airport (ABV) is 2104 miles or 3385 kilometers or 1827 nautical miles.

Why should you arrive 3 hours before international flight? Flyers who are traveling to an international destination should arrive at the airport earlier than domestic flyers. This is because international flights can have additional check-in requirements, like passport verification, that need to be completed before you receive your boarding pass.
